Water-based sustainable projects in Center of Portugal
Water is a pivotal concern of nations worldwide and Portugal is in this scope no exception, struggling against water scarcity, especially in the inland regions. In Center of Portugal, the prestigious Universities of Aveiro and University of Beira Interior, in Covilhã, are at the forefront of innovative water-based sustainable projects, developing smart nature-based solutions to reduce water consumption and to protect biodiversity and natural ecosystems, while raising public awareness on urgent sustainable practices. Faith beads
The rosary business in Fátima goes back to the 20's of the 20th century. Although some part of this activity has preserved a handmade dimension, nowadays the most successful rosary-making company in Portugal, Farportugal sells mostly to the foreign markets, producing 1 million rosaries every year. Nazaré Big Waves
The Nazaré Canyon is the reason why the waves are so big and so high breaking. This makes Nazaré a hotspot for big wave surfing.
